Abstract

Crystalline 1,10-diazonia-18-crown-6 diiodide dihydrate was synthesized and studied by single crystal X-ray diffraction. The salt exists in the crystal in the form of separate centrosymmetrical ionic molecules [(H2DA18C6)2+ ⋅ 2I− ⋅ 2H2O] whose components are held together by hydrogen bonds and electrostatic attraction forces. The centrosymmetric dication DA18C6 (with two protonated nitrogen atoms) has a crown conformation with approximate D3d symmetry. The iodide ions are arranged at the nitrogen atoms (one above and the other below) of the DA18C6 dication, and two water molecules are arranged above and below its symmetry center. Each water molecule is disordered over two positions with occupancies of 0.65 and 0.35.
